Calorie Control: The Cornerstone of Rapid Weight Loss

At its core, weight loss boils down to burning more calories than you consume. But not all calorie deficits are created equal. Extreme calorie restriction can backfire by slowing metabolism and causing muscle loss. Instead, a moderate deficit of 500 to 1000 calories per day typically results in safe and effective weight loss of about 1-2 pounds per week.

Focusing on nutrient-dense foods that are low in calories but high in fiber and protein helps keep you full longer. Protein is especially important because it supports muscle maintenance during weight loss and has a higher thermic effect compared to fats or carbohydrates—meaning your body burns more calories digesting protein.

The Role of Exercise in Rapid Weight Loss

Exercise is an irreplaceable component when asking what helps lose weight quickly? It not only burns calories but also preserves lean muscle mass and improves metabolic rate. Combining both cardio and strength training yields the best results.

Aerobic Exercise for Fat Burning

Cardio workouts like running, cycling, swimming, or brisk walking increase heart rate and calorie expenditure significantly. High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) has gained popularity because short bursts of intense activity followed by recovery periods burn more calories in less time compared to steady-state cardio.

Strength Training to Maintain Muscle

Muscle tissue burns more calories at rest than fat tissue does. Incorporating resistance training ensures you lose fat rather than muscle during rapid weight loss phases. Exercises using weights or bodyweight (like squats, push-ups) improve body composition and boost metabolism long-term.

Exercise Type Calories Burned (30 mins) Main Benefit
Running (6 mph) 295-400 High calorie burn; boosts endurance
HIIT Workout 250-350+ EPOC effect; burns fat post-exercise
Strength Training (Moderate) 90-130 Preserves muscle; increases metabolism
Cycling (Moderate pace) 210-310 Lowers fat; improves cardiovascular health
Walking (Brisk pace) 120-180 Sustainable daily activity; low injury risk

The Importance of Hydration and Sleep in Weight Loss

Drinking enough water is often overlooked but plays a vital role in quick weight loss. Water helps maintain metabolism efficiency and can curb hunger when consumed before meals. Sometimes thirst disguises itself as hunger leading to unnecessary snacking.

Sleep impacts hormones regulating appetite—ghrelin (stimulates hunger) and leptin (signals fullness). Poor sleep increases ghrelin levels while lowering leptin causing overeating and cravings for high-calorie foods.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ep nightly to support your weight loss journey.

The Science Behind Metabolism and Quick Weight Loss

Metabolism refers to the chemical processes converting food into energy. A faster metabolism means more calories burned at rest which aids quicker weight loss. Factors influencing metabolic rate include age, genetics, muscle mass, hormone levels, and activity level.

Increasing lean muscle through strength training directly elevates basal metabolic rate (BMR). Eating small frequent meals with adequate protein also prevents metabolic slowdown common with extreme dieting.

Some people turn to intermittent fasting—a pattern cycling between eating windows and fasting periods—to control calorie intake without constant restriction. Research suggests intermittent fasting may improve insulin sensitivity and promote fat burning though individual responses vary widely.

The Impact of Hormones on Rapid Weight Loss Efforts

Hormones like insulin regulate how your body stores fat while thyroid hormones influence metabolic speed. Imbalances caused by stress or medical conditions can slow down progress despite best efforts.

Balancing blood sugar through complex carbs instead of refined sugars prevents insulin spikes that encourage fat accumulation. Regular sleep patterns keep cortisol in check reducing belly fat gain associated with chronic stress.

If stubborn weight persists despite lifestyle changes consider consulting an endocrinologist to rule out hormonal disorders such as hypothyroidism or pol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S).
